Moller – Maersk nominates Amparo Moraleda for election to its Board of Directors

– DENMARK, Copenhagen –  A.P. Moller – Maersk (CPH: MAERSK-B) today announced the nomination of Amparo Moraleda for election to its Board of Directors as a new member, at the next AGM to be held on 23 March 2021.

“With experience from IBM and Iberdrola, Amparo will further strengthen the Board’s competencies in relation to digitalisation and sustainability”, said Jim Hagemann Snabe, Chairman of the Board of Directors.

About Amparo Moraleda

Amparo Moraleda is a Spanish national and educated as Industrial Engineer at ICAI in Madrid, Spain and holds a PDG (Programa de Direccion General) from IESE Business School, Universidad de Navarra, Spain.

Amparo Moraleda has board experience from international listed technology, chemical, aerospace, transportation, automotive, and innovation companies and the financial sector. Currently, she serves as a board member in Solvay (Belgium), Caixabank (Spain), Airbus SE (the Netherlands), and Vodafone Group (UK).

As an executive Amparo Moraleda has worked as COO for Iberdrola S.A. and as General Manager for IBM.
